Hello. My first time with an issue... thanks in advance for helping!

We have an asus all in one pc, Martin M-Touch Controller and 16 Blizzard Hotbox 5 RGBAW LED Cans. The system is very simple. The dmx cable is plugged into can 16 and then daisy chained back to can 1. Things have been working great for 2 years. All of a sudden, things don’t work. The first thing I noticed was that fixture 1 was outputting a dull green. Everything else was off. The controller and MPC software were working great, but the lights would not respond to any software commands. I took 1 can to the A/V booth for testing. The DMX address is 001. I created a new show, patched it but there is no response. When I navigate thru the hotbox menu, I can adjust the light, color and intensity. As soon as I plug in the dmx cable, which is connected to the controller, the dull green starts again. So I powered the can off, unplugged the dmx from the controller and only plugged it into the can. Plugged the power it and it came on as normal. As soon as I connect it to the m-touch it starts that dull green again. I tried different dmx cables and tested the 5-pin to 3-pin for continuity with my multimeter. Everything is testing good.

I reinstalled the MPC software with the instructions from the Martin website. Did all firmware updates to the m-touch and retested. Same results. My conclusion is that the M-Touch is no longer working, even though it is responsive with the MPC software. Something about the dmx signal out is not working.

Any thoughts?
